How can a Coin Laundry POS Procedure link with more mature equipment?
Classic washers and dryers were intended to recognise cash, not cards or apps. A POS process bridges that hole working with hardware retrofits:
Pulse interfaces: mimic the coin fall signal, tricking the device into wondering it’s obtained a coin.
MDB (Multi-Drop Bus) connections: plug into devices with modern-day vending protocols.
Intelligent Management packing containers: central hubs that permit contactless payment, app-centered credits, and in some cases loyalty points.
This retrofit technique suggests laundromats don’t need to rip out properly very good equipment—they can modernise incrementally.

Do POS techniques help with enterprise management too?
Yes. Further than payments, a Coin Laundry POS Process commonly comes along with a cloud dashboard that offers entrepreneurs real-time visibility more than their equipment:
Which devices are in use or click here idle
Complete takings (split by card, application, or coin)
Device maintenance alerts
Shopper conduct insights, like peak wash situations
This knowledge isn’t just beneficial for functions—it could possibly guidebook advertising, pricing strategy, and growth organizing. Think of it as shifting from “coin counting” to “small business intelligence”.
